Table Status (was Re: problems with height of cells in tables)
Hi Arved (and other interested parties), Lots of other bugs (like the inline-area height) show up well in tables because the grid makes things visible. That's the case with the trailing white-space bug I saw the other day, resulting in an empty table row. Some of these can also be shown by using border, padding and background on fo:block, which also needs more test cases. I think base-level table functionality has gotten considerably better, and we need to publicize that with the next release, since there have been so many problems in the past releases. Of course, I know there are still a number of bugs, but I think the row-spanning, vertical alignment and general border-handling improvements should help lots of people. Off the top of my head, here are major areas for work: 1. border-collapse=collapse. There is a partial bandaid for this now. I've written a lot of pseudo-code for this, as the general case is quite complex. It should take into account cell, row and column borders (though I'd like to see the final word in the PR on this). As often, I ran up against the problem of handling the break conditions, since that can affect the borders. But unless someone else has done lots of work here or has some easy improvements, I'd like to keep it on my plate (after vacation). 2. Keeps and breaks. There are some cases where breaks cause problems; as I recall the culprit is in table-body. I know the general problem of keeps can't really be handled, but tables are a particularly sore point for that. It's worth trying to do keep-together for table-row; actually I think I did a first pass on this when I did spans. 3. Handling limit conditions, like table-row with keeps but which doesn't fit on the page. 4. Indents. Just looked at Koen's bug, which involves the indents not affecting the table itself, but rather the cell content. My reading of the CR is that the areas created by fo:table are block areas and should be positioned by indents. Lots of people also want to center their tables; I can't figure out how this is supposed to happen, unless it's in table-and-capation. 5. The table-and-caption fo. 6. Row-less tables using start-row and end-row properties on the cells. I think this can be handled in addChild for the table-body by creating "fake" TableRow objects as needed. 7. Automatic table layout style (this is a fairly big deal). Or at least really implement the percentage stuff, which would be simpler and still quite flexible. This needs some work in calculating the column widths once the size of the containing reference area is known. 8. The relative-align style for vertical alignment. Needs post-processing once all cells in the row are done. Might as well wait until we get our line-stacking straightened out. That should keep people thinking for a while... When I was doing the "redesign", I was working on the concept of creating inline areas for all inline type objects (except wrappers). I was going to just make one big "inline flow set" with all the inline areas in a single sequence, and then do the breaking from there. Once the line breaks were determined, then we can do the line-height calculations according to the rules and the values of the different properties. The biggest problem with having the actual text at different levels in the tree is for doing things like white-space handling, word-breaking hyphenation etc (assuming that at least some of those should abstract from the actual inline tree). Along those lines, and after trying to understand the white-space handling in LineArea, I was wondering if it wouldn't be possible to do that while building the FO tree. I was thinking of some kind of state machine and using an iterator over the FO tree to abstract the level problem. Sounds like I need to look into Peter's Tree work. Hi Peter, Thanks for the test files. Yes, you are right that font metrics influence the calculation. In fact, these examples point out a number of problems with FOP's line sizing logic. The sizing is really determined by the font-family and font-size specified or inherited on the fo:block containing the text. The actual size of the text is ignored in calculating the line height! So the last four lines of your table correspond to this: 1. 18pt, Arial 2. 18pt, default font-family (sans-serif) 3. default font-size (12pt), Arial 4. default font-size (12pt), default font-family (sans-serif) The font metrics for Arial obviously have a larger ascender value than those for the default font. So much for the explanations. Unfortunately, I'm not sure I'll try to fix this right away, since I fear that it involves some rather major changes. It really comes down to the fact that the fo:inline object doesn't actually generate a nested inline area, but just adds characters to the LineArea. So there's no place for it to actually store the line-height information. Perhaps someone else will be be braver. In any case, it's certainly on the list for the layout redesign... Hi Petr, I've looked at this quickly and my first reaction is that it's probably not specific to tables. I think it has to do with line-height (aka leading in old typographic terms). Neither font-size nor line-height are specified at a high level in your .fo. The default font-size is 12pt and the default line-height 1.2 em (14.4pt). When you set font-size at the block level as in the last row, that will also change the line-height, since it's relative, so the total height is smaller. When you set font-size at the inline or wrapper, it apparently isn't changing line-height. I guess since line-height can be specified for both fo:ineline and fo:character (via the fo:wrapper), that the line-height should also be modified by setting font-size on those objects too. Good eye!
